Daunia is one of nine metallurgical coal mines in Queensland's Bowen Basin and is located on the traditional lands of the Barada Barna people.

Daunia at a glance

The Daunia coal mine is a part of BMA, the 50:50 joint venture between BHP and Mitsubishi Development. Daunia mine is located south-east of Moranbah in Queensland’s Bowen Basin.
2013 The mine was opened in 2013.
450 We created 450 new jobs when the mine opened. 
1 It takes around 770kg of met coal to make the steel used in one mid-sized car.

The total investment in the Daunia mine start-up was $US1.4 billion, and in 2020, we invested a further $100 million to introduce 34 autonomous trucks into the mine, resulting in contracts worth $35 million being awarded to local and Indigenous businesses.

Metallurgical coal

Metallurgical coal (sometimes referred to as coking coal) is a naturally occurring sedimentary rock found within the Earth’s crust.
